You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

最大待处理中断

最大待处理中断是指在系统中存在多个中断请求时,系统只能处理其中一个中断请求,而其他中断请求需要等待处理的情况。为了解决最大待处理中断问题,可以采取以下几种方法:

  1. 增加中断处理器数量:通过增加中断处理器的数量,可以同时处理更多的中断请求,从而减少最大待处理中断的数量。这可以通过使用多核处理器或者多个处理器来实现。

  2. 优化中断处理程序:对中断处理程序进行优化,减少中断处理的时间,从而能够更快地处理中断请求。这可以通过优化代码、减少中断处理的步骤或者使用高效的算法来实现。

  3. 使用中断优先级:为不同的中断请求设置优先级,优先处理优先级较高的中断请求,从而减少最大待处理中断的数量。这可以通过在中断控制器中设置中断优先级,或者在中断处理程序中根据中断请求的优先级来决定处理顺序。

以下是一个示例代码,演示如何使用中断优先级来解决最大待处理中断问题(使用C语言):

// 定义中断请求的优先级
#define HIGH_PRIORITY 1
#define LOW_PRIORITY 2

// 中断处理程序
void interrupt_handler(int priority) {
    // 处理中断请求
}

int main() {
    // 模拟中断请求
    int interrupt_requests[] = {HIGH_PRIORITY, LOW_PRIORITY, HIGH_PRIORITY, HIGH_PRIORITY, LOW_PRIORITY};

    // 设置中断优先级
    int interrupt_priorities[] = {HIGH_PRIORITY, LOW_PRIORITY};

    // 处理中断请求
    for (int i = 0; i < sizeof(interrupt_priorities) / sizeof(interrupt_priorities[0]); i++) {
        for (int j = 0; j < sizeof(interrupt_requests) / sizeof(interrupt_requests[0]); j++) {
            if (interrupt_requests[j] == interrupt_priorities[i]) {
                // 处理中断请求
                interrupt_handler(interrupt_requests[j]);
            }
        }
    }

    return 0;
}

在上述示例代码中,使用两个不同的中断优先级,其中高优先级为1,低优先级为2。根据中断请求的优先级,首先处理高优先级的中断请求,然后处理低优先级的中断请求。这样可以保证在系统中存在多个中断请求时,能够优先处理高优先级的中断请求,从而减少最大待处理中断的数量。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

干货|4000字总结,Serverless在OLAP领域应用的五点思考

因为 Serverless 平台通常设置了最大运行时间的限制,超过限制时间会导致任务中断。 **2. 计算密集型** :Serverless 技术通常适用于处理轻量级任务,而对于高计算密集型任务,需要更多计算资源,但行业上目前当前尚未有商用的Serverless 数据仓库能够提供超过2000 vcore的算力规模,而2000vcore折算成通用的物理机或裸金属,也不过是20台服务器的算力规模,往往一些中型的分析型系统的算力需求就远远超过这个规模。...

基于火山引擎微服务引擎 MSE 的全链路灰度落地实践

最大限度降低对在线用户影响,保障版本发布质量,通常采用 **灰度发布**的方式将少量的实际生产流量导入至更新版本,达到预期结果及充分测试验证后,将流量渐进式切流至更新版本随即完成基线版本服务下线。然... 引发灰度流量中断或异常。# **全链路灰度设计与实现**## **2.1 设计原则**经过上述剖析,结合业界及字节跳动内部实践,我们可以简单总结出微服务场景全链路灰度发布的设计原则:![picture.image](http...

Actor模型 - 分布式应用框架Akka

一个Actor在同一时间处理最多一个消息,可以发送消息给其他Actor,保证了单独写原则,从而巧妙避免了多线程写争夺。和共享数据方式相比,消息传递机制最大的优点就是不会产生数据竞争状态。 **Actor模型的特点是:... **线程中断规则** `(Thread Interruption Rule)`:对线程的`interrupt()`方法调用先行发生于被中断的线程的代码检测到中断事件的发生。7. **对象终结规则** `(Finalizer Rule)`:一个对象的初始化完成先行发生于...

万字长文带你漫游数据结构世界|社区征文

不能完全独立来看待,但是本文会相对重点聊聊那些常用的数据结构。**数据结构是什么呢?**首先得知道数据是什么?**数据是对客观事务的符号表示**,在计算机科学中是指所有能输入到计算机中并被计算机程序处理的符... 也就是8位的最大值是`01111111`,也就是`127`。值得我们注意的是,计算机的世界里,多了原码,反码,补码的概念:- 原码:用第一位表示符号,其余位表示值- 反码:正数的补码反码是其本身,负数的反码是符号位保持不变,...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

最大待处理中断-优选内容

干货|4000字总结,Serverless在OLAP领域应用的五点思考
因为 Serverless 平台通常设置了最大运行时间的限制,超过限制时间会导致任务中断。 **2. 计算密集型** :Serverless 技术通常适用于处理轻量级任务,而对于高计算密集型任务,需要更多计算资源,但行业上目前当前尚未有商用的Serverless 数据仓库能够提供超过2000 vcore的算力规模,而2000vcore折算成通用的物理机或裸金属,也不过是20台服务器的算力规模,往往一些中型的分析型系统的算力需求就远远超过这个规模。...
DescribeSystemEvents
导致实例重新部署 CreateInstance:创建实例 RunInstance:启动实例 StopInstance:停止实例 DeleteInstance:删除实例 SpotInstanceInterruption_Delete:抢占型实例中断,实例释放 AccountUnbalanced_Stop:账户欠费,实... MaxResults Integer 否 20 分页查询时设置的每页行数: 最大值:100 默认值:20 返回数据名称 类型 示例值 描述 NextToken String bHpwdXJja2RxemU1eG5sb3NzdGcW1-RC****** 本次调用返回的查询凭证值,返回为空表...
基于火山引擎微服务引擎 MSE 的全链路灰度落地实践
最大限度降低对在线用户影响,保障版本发布质量,通常采用 **灰度发布**的方式将少量的实际生产流量导入至更新版本,达到预期结果及充分测试验证后,将流量渐进式切流至更新版本随即完成基线版本服务下线。然... 引发灰度流量中断或异常。# **全链路灰度设计与实现**## **2.1 设计原则**经过上述剖析,结合业界及字节跳动内部实践,我们可以简单总结出微服务场景全链路灰度发布的设计原则:![picture.image](http...
ModifySubscriptionEventTypes
导致实例重新部署:待响应 GpuError.Redeploy:Succeeded:GPU异常,导致实例重新部署:执行成功 SpotInstanceInterruption.Delete:Scheduled:抢占型实例中断,实例释放:计划执行 SpotInstanceInterruption.Delete:Su... 指定的EventTypes超过最大限制。 400 MissingParameter.SubscriptionId The required parameter SubscriptionId is not supplied. 参数SubscriptionId不能为空。 404 InvalidSubscription.NotFound The spe...

最大待处理中断-相关内容

内外统一的边缘原生云基础设施架构——火山引擎边缘云

才能发挥两者最大的价值。** # **01 业务发展为边缘计算云基础设施带来新的挑战** 边缘计算的发展带来好处的同时,也在云基础设施架构方面带来许多挑战。 ![picture.image](https://p6-volc-co... **高带宽:** 边缘计算就近处理和传输,能够承载更大的带宽。- **节约成本:** 边缘计算可以减少客户端与中心节点通信的数据量,从而帮助客户节约了较多的带宽成本。- **数据安全:** 数据在边缘节点进行预处...

火山引擎ByteHouse:4000字总结,Serverless在OLAP领域应用的五点思考

因为 Serverless 平台通常设置了最大运行时间的限制,超过限制时间会导致任务中断。2. **计算密集型**:Serverless 技术通常适用于处理轻量级任务,而对于高计算密集型任务,需要更多计算资源,但行业上目前当前尚未有商用的Serverless 数据仓库能够提供超过2000 vcore的算力规模,而2000vcore折算成通用的物理机或裸金属,也不过是20台服务器的算力规模,往往一些中型的分析型系统的算力需求就远远超过这个规模。3. **高并发读写型...

Flink OLAP Improvement of Resource Management and Runtime

Flink OLAP 作业 QPS 和资源隔离是 Flink OLAP 计算面临的最大难题,也是字节跳动内部业务使用 Flink 执行 OLAP 计算需要解决的最大痛点。本次分享将围绕 Flink OLAP 难点和瓶颈分析、作业调度、Runtime 执行、收益... 此外资源分配中 SlotPool 处理 Slot 申请和分配比较复杂,每个 Task 需要获取上游 Task 的分配位置,同时 Share Group 分配资源有多次排序和遍历,增加了 Slot 分配的耗时,这个随着作业复杂度上升,耗时也会增加。!...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

前端 code lint 和代码风格指南

`@typescript-eslint/parser` 处理所有特定于 ESLint 的配置,然后调用 `@typescript-eslint/typescript-estree` 。这个包只用来将 TypeScript source code 转为一个适当的 AST 。1. `@typescript-eslint/types... 如果代码跨越了最大的行宽,就会中断它。Prettier 禁止所有自定义样式,方法是将源代码解析成 AST 后,使用自己的规则同时考虑最大行宽,并在必要时换行,重新输出格式化的代码。## Prettier 和 linters 有何区别?l...

数据结构

被以下接口引用: MySQL2MySQLSettings 参数 类型 是否必选 描述 示例值 Account String 是 待迁移的账号名称。 test**** ResetPassword Bool 否 是否重置密码,取值如下: true:表示重置新密码。 false:表示不重置... MySQL2RocketMQSettings PG2PGSettings PG2KafkaSettings PG2RocketMQSettings Mongo2MongoSettings Redis2RedisSettings 参数 类型 是否必选 描述 示例值 MaxRetrySeconds Integer 否 最大错误重试时间。取...

干货 | BitSail Connector开发详解系列一:Source

大数据处理框架的核心目的就是将大规模的数据拆分成为多个合理的Split并行处理。● **State:** 作业状态快照,当开启checkpoint之后,会保存当前执行状态。 **一、Source** 数据读取组件的生命... 来对数据进行最大、最小值的划分;对于无主键类则通常会将其认定为一个split,不再进行拆分,所以split中的参数包括主键的最大最小值,以及一个布尔类型的readTable。 如果无主键类或是不进行主键的切分...

Cilium 原理解析:网络数据包在内核中的流转过程

网卡就会触发一个硬件中断(HW IRQ),告诉处理器 DMA 区域中有包等待处理。4. 收到硬中断信号后,处理器开始执行 NAPI。5. NAPI 执行网卡注册的 poll 方法开始收包。关于 NAPI poll 机制:- Linux 内核在 2.6 版本中引入了 NAPI 机制,它是混合「中断和轮询」的方式来接收网络包,它的核心概念就是不采用中断的方式读取数据,而是首先采用中断唤醒数据接收的服务程序,然后 poll 的方法来轮询数据。- 驱动注册的这个 p...

云原生时代,如何从 0 到 1 构建 K8s 容器平台的 LB(Nginx)负载均衡体系|社区征文

* 网卡软中断 * 网络带宽:流入和流出带宽指标、网卡丢包指标 * 内存使用、swap 使用 * 磁盘 IO:读、写两方面 * 剩余句柄数* LB 代理层的基本业务指标监控 * SLA * 错误统计 * ... 对于老连接是怎么处理的,一个确定的流程是:* 如果当前连接是空闲状态,那么直接关闭* 如果当前连接还在等待 upstream response,那么会等待请求处理结束或者超时 (proxy_read_timeout),再关闭这一过程对于短连接...

ModifyListenerAttributes

监听器带宽峰值最大不能超过所属CLB实例的规格带宽,CLB实例的规格带宽请参见产品规格。 说明 监听器限速功能正在邀测中,如需使用,请联系客户经理。 AclIds.N String 否 AclIds.1=acl-3cj44nv0jhhxc6c6rrtet*... ConnectionDrainEnabled String 否 on 监听器是否开启连接优雅中断功能。取值如下: on:开启。 off:不开启。 说明 仅四层监听器(TCP或UDP协议)支持配置为on。 该功能正在邀测中,如需使用,请联系客户经理。 ...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询